My VAWA Timeline

May 5, 2014 - Filed First VAWA

September 3, 2014 - Filed I485 and I765

September 7, 2014 - Found out USCIS administratively closed my i360 because US postal service sent my RFE letter back to Vermont

October 10, 2014 - Biometrics Appointment for i485

Sent USCIS to reopen case, scheduled infopass, wrote to ombudsman

November 4, 2014 - Filed Second VAWA

December 23, 2014 - i765 Approved

January 2, 2015 - Received i765 Card

January 5, 2015 - Applied for SSN

January 12, 2015 - Approval of second Vawa

Approval of second vawa took 2 months and 12 days! No RFE. God is great!

February 9, 2015 - I-485 File is transferred to NBC

May 5,2015 - Received Interview letter for I 485

May 14, 2015 - Interview date

June 22, 2015 - Received Welcome letter and Approval letter. Will receive Green Card within 2-3 weeks

Flexx you must change the address, it's the law.If you have a lawyer he/she will continue receiving the mail.YOu have to mail a notarized letter,and after 10 days go to infopass to confirm if they changed .

can i do it online at egov.uscis.gov ??

Link to comment
Share on other sites

Flexx

NO, vawa petitioners are not allowed to change it online (privacy issues), you must send a notarized letter. Check their website

http://www.uscis.gov/addresschange

Wildflower21 a motion to reopen takes 4/6months , and can be granted or not.YOu have the options to file a motion, to refile Vawa again or ask the supervisor reconsideration, remind you that the 2 options(motion or supervisor reconsideration ) can be granted or denied .You have to decide what you want to do.Do not try to submit a motion without a lawyer.FInd a pro bono lawyer to do that .
